Problems solved by technology

[0005] The existing mold is used to repair the insulation layer. Due to the poor sealing of the contact part between the mold and the waterproof cap and the contact part between the waterproof cap and the oil and gas pipeline, the pressure in the cavity formed by the mold and the oil and gas pipeline cannot be kept constant, resulting in foaming The porosity, foam strength and flatness of the formed insulation layer did not meet the preset indicators, and the quality of the repaired insulation layer could not meet the requirements of the standard specification

Abstract

The invention discloses a foaming sleeve device and belongs to the field of repairing of pipeline hear preservation layers. The foaming sleeve device comprises a sleeve pipe body, a feed inlet, an exhaust hole and at least two positioning modules. Each positioning module comprises an elastic element, a telescopic rod, an elastic element support and a sealing rubber pad. The feed inlet and the exhaust hole are located in through holes in the sleeve pipe body. The positioning modules are distributed at the two ends of the sleeve pipe body separately. The sealing rubber pad of each positioning module makes contact with the outer surface of an oil-gas pipeline. The sealing rubber pads are connected with the elastic element supports of the positioning modules, and the elastic element supports are connected with the elastic elements of the positioning modules. As the oil-gas pipeline is tightly sleeved with the sleeve pipe body, the positioning modules are arranged, and the sealing rubber pads of the positioning modules make contact with the outer surface of the oil-gas pipeline, the airtightness of a foaming cavity is improved, the foaming process can be conducted in the foaming cavitywith good airtightness, and the quality of the repaired heat preservation layers can meet the standard requirements.

Description

technical field [0001] The invention relates to the technical field of pipe insulation layer repair, in particular to a foam sleeve device. Background technique [0002] In order to prevent oil and gas pipelines from bursting due to temperature and other reasons, it is necessary to add an insulation layer to the outer surface of the oil and gas pipeline. With the operation of oil and gas pipelines for many years, the insulation layer of oil and gas pipelines will also fail. Therefore, it is necessary to repair the insulation layer in time after the insulation layer of oil and gas pipelines fails. [0003] In practical applications, the insulation layer can be repaired by using the method of on-site foaming of the mold.
